## What did Urenco USA announce?

Urenco USA, the only US commercial uranium-enrichment company, plans a multi-billion-dollar investment to increase its enrichment capacity by almost 50%. The company made the announcement on Tuesday. It cited surging demand for nuclear reactors as the reason.

The investment will fund a new enrichment plant at Urenco's existing facility in southeast New Mexico. The first of 24 sets of centrifuges will be operational from 2032, [according to Bloomberg via Advisor Perspectives](https://www.advisorperspectives.com/articles/2026/06/02/biggest-us-nuclear-fuel-enricher-bet-ai-boom).

## Why is this expansion happening now?

The US needs large amounts of electricity to power [AI data centers](/articles/doe-rfi-ai-data-centers). Nuclear power has emerged as a major source for that demand. The Trump administration is pushing to quadruple output from nuclear plants. That goal requires a significant increase in uranium fuel production.

Urenco's existing New Mexico facility currently handles roughly one-third of domestic annual demand. The company operates four production facilities globally. ## What did Urenco's CEO say?

Boris Schucht, chief executive officer of Urenco, explained the company's reasoning directly. "This expansion reinforces our commitment to a resilient US nuclear fuel supply chain focused on meeting the long-term needs of our customers as well as supporting US energy security," [Schucht said](https://www.advisorperspectives.com/articles/2026/06/02/biggest-us-nuclear-fuel-enricher-bet-ai-boom).

The statement points to both commercial demand and national energy security as drivers of the decision.

## Where will the new plant be built?

The new enrichment plant will be built at Urenco's existing site in southeast New Mexico. It will not be a standalone facility. Instead, it will expand what is already the largest uranium-enrichment operation in the US.

The first centrifuge set is scheduled to come online in 2032. All 24 sets will follow after that. The phased approach allows Urenco to scale output as reactor demand grows.
